My Students

Let's get this beat started! My percussion students have made due with improper mallets and equipment for too long!

We are a Title 1, inner city school in CT.

I teach instrumental music and band to grades 4-8. In my experience, many of the best percussionists I have taught have greatly benefited from being in band. Being a percussionist requires focus, patience, and attention to detail, and all these things have helped my students in other areas of their school work. Being in band, for my students, is a privilege. Students have to be doing well in their classes and keep their behavior in check in order to participate. I have seen students turn around with school work because playing the drums had become an incentive!

My Project

We've made due with improper mallets in the past, but as my band grows and advances, they need to have the right equipment to prepare them for high school and to keep our own drums in good shape. Our rehearsal space is a cafeteria auditorium, so we need drum pads to use in rehearsals to control the volume that the drums produce. We don't have any stands for the drum pads that we have; currently, we use inverted music stands. My students deserve to have good, proper equipment! They are hard working, dedicated, and inspired musicians! They know that we don't have the proper mallets for marching band, but they have had to accept the fact that we don't have the money in the budget for these items. School budgets are cut every year, and our administration works with us to get us our essentials; sadly, our drum mallets and drum pads have been put off for far too long.

My students deserve the same opportunities and equipment as any other school's band!

Making due with what we have is no longer o.k. when we are stepping up the difficultly level of music and musicianship. With your help, we will be improving the quality of our drummers performance and outlook on what it means to be a percussionist!
